01Is .73 mm thin or thick?

Medium. Thin picks run around .50 mm and heavy picks start near 1 mm. At .73 mm you get moderate flex — it bends slightly on hard strums but holds firm for lead lines.

02How many picks is 6 dozen?

72 picks.

03Can I use these on bass or acoustic?

Yes. Pick gauge is a feel preference, not instrument-specific. Bassists often prefer heavier picks, but .73 mm works on acoustic and electric alike.

04What does the wedge shape change?

A wedge tapers to a more defined point than a rounded pick. That gives a crisper attack on single notes and a slightly brighter, more articulate sound on strums.
